Market failures occur when the competitive market does not allocate resources efficiently. Gruber provides extensive coverage of externalities, such as pollution. The 7th edition updates these discussions with modern data on climate change policies, carbon taxes, and cap-and-trade systems. 2. Social Insurance and Redistribution
